ARROGANT GOVERNMENT IGNORED PRISON OVERCROWDING - WILLOTT

1.53.10pm GMT Wed 24th Jan 2007

Responding to John Reid's letter to judges requesting that they use alternatives to prison except for the most dangerous offenders, Jenny Willott Welsh Liberal Democrat MP for Cardiff Central, said:

"In the long-list of government failures in home affairs, the prison overcrowding crisis ranks amongst the worst.

"A mixture of arrogance and incompetence led the Government to ignore warnings about prison numbers, which were first expressed several years ago.

"Welsh prisons are almost 40% over capacity squeezing in an extra 700 inmates over the number they were actually designed to hold.

"There is a strong case to review the mix of offenders sent to prison, but these short-term panic fixes by this Government will provide nothing but temporary sticking plaster solutions to a much deeper crisis.

"Quite simply, the Government has only itself to blame for this lamentable state of affairs."
